Joshua Pippens has accused a 10-year-old boy, whom he reportedly helped raise with his mother Travonna, of shooting him during a domestic dispute. The incident took place when the boy allegedly took a gun from Pippens' hip and fired it while trying to protect his mother.

 

 

Pippens, however, denied being the "aggressor" in the situation. He shared security footage of the incident on Instagram, stating that he still had his gun on his hip and that the boy grabbed it, following his mother's lead, and shot him. Pippens emphasized the importance of viewing the footage before it potentially gets taken down.

"As y’all can see I was not the aggressor and y’all also can see how I still had my gun on my hip he grabbed my gun off my hip following his moms lead and tried to shoot me and then actually shot me I advise y’all see it before they take it down." - Joshua Pippens

 

Pippens reiterated his innocence, highlighting that he has custody of his children, while Travonna does not. He expressed gratitude for surviving the incident, adding that he is enduring this ordeal, urging others to take their situations seriously.
